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2004.01.13;
Скачать: CL | DM;

Вниз

Одним запросом все таблицы...   Найти похожие ветки 

 
Mikka ©   (2003-12-16 10:37) [0]

Добр. день...
Маленький вопросик...как правильно составить запрос, чтобы он, допустим искал строку "qwerty" во всех полях и во всех таблицах базы(не перечисляя эти таблицы, их свыше 100)?


 
Семен Сорокин ©   (2003-12-16 10:44) [1]

я думаю надо работать с системными таблицами, генерить скрипт и запускать его через exec()


 
Семен Сорокин ©   (2003-12-16 10:46) [2]

см. таблицы sysobjects и syscolumns


 
Sergey13 ©   (2003-12-16 10:56) [3]

А можно перефразировать вопрос на "зачем и надо ли искать строку во ВСЕХ таблицах" и ответив на него ничего не делать. 8-)


 
DenK_vrtz ©   (2003-12-16 11:00) [4]

Список таблиц известен(берем из системных таблиц) cм.Семен Сорокин ©
Делаем в цикле запрос к каждой таблице select * from table,
а после выполнения зарпоса пробегаем по всем полям и записям и ищем нужное значение в каждом значении поля.


 
Ega23 ©   (2003-12-16 11:17) [5]

А результат запроса в каком виде должен быть?


 
Mikka ©   (2003-12-16 12:06) [6]

Сибо всем...Дальше попробую разобраться сам
Сергей13...конечно лучше ничего не делать...пока ищешь одно -
находишь и другое.


 
Sergey13 ©   (2003-12-17 08:58) [7]

2Mikka © (16.12.03 12:06) [6]
>конечно лучше ничего не делать...пока ищешь одно -
находишь и другое.
Забавная у тебя работа. Ищешь то - не знаешь что и при этом находишь другое. 8-)



Страницы: 1 вся ветка

Текущий архив: 2004.01.13;
Скачать: CL | DM;

Наверх




Память: 0.48 MB
Время: 0.022 c
14-37870
Undert
2003-12-22 17:46
2004.01.13
Приемущества и недостатки домена


3-37522
Sandman25
2003-12-16 17:33
2004.01.13
Insert и Autoincrement


1-37777
MaxNv
2003-12-31 01:14
2004.01.13
Как вытащить значения переменной типа set?


1-37742
Ego
2003-12-30 08:27
2004.01.13
Вставить фрейм


14-37897
z.Evgen
2003-12-19 08:45
2004.01.13
Как можно разбить строку на символы?